Ministers

Former Minister of Education: * Rasool Amin (20011222-200206) * Yunus Qanooni (200206-20040831) * Ahmad Moshahed (20040831-200412) * Noor Moh. Qarqeen (20041223 -20060302) * Hanif Atmar (200603), * Dr. Farooq Wardak (20081022-20140930) confirmed for second term by Wolesi Jirga (20100103), * Dr. Farooq Wardak acting Minister (20141001) * acting Minister of Education MoE Muhammad Asef Nang (20141209) * Dr. Asadullah Hanif Balkhi (20150418, 20160522, 20161113 impeached and acting) * Mohammad Shah Ibrahim Shinwari, nominated (20171123) * Dr. Mirwais Balkhi, acting (20180319, 20190107) * Sheikh Mawlawi Munir Nurullah (20210911) * Maulvi Habibullah Agha (20220920) acting Deputy Minister of Education: Deputy Minister for Administration and Finance: * Sulaiman Kakar Muhammad Suleman Kakar (20100222), * u/i Function: Mohammad Sidiq Patman (2006, 20110326) * Deputy Minister of Islamic studies affairs: Dr. Shafiq Samim (20111018) Deputy Minister of Education for Technical Evaluation: * Sarwar Azizi, (20100809) * Muhammad Asif Nang (20101228) * Asadullah Mohaqiq (20141013, 20170101) Ministry of education’s deputy * Dr. Mohammad Ibrahim Shinwari (20171111) * Deputy Minister of Education Abdul Hakim Hemat (20220329) * Mawlawi Sakhaullah (20211005) * Maulvi Saeed Ahmad Shahidkhel (20211122)
